Default AAM Shop Review

I recently had a small issue with my AAM exhaust where the resonator pipe cracked at one of the welds(This wasn't an AAM weld but rather a weld of the resonator manufacturer). This caused a horrible exhaust leak, ridiculous sound and it seemed to have an effect on how smoothly the engine ran.

I called up AAM looking to see what I could do to get a replacement pipe and Clint promptly sourced a replacement part, talked with Mike about it and called me back all within a matter of about an hour or so. I didn't set an appointment but instead just called ahead when I was on my way. I get there and within 10 minutes Clint has a lift cleared for me and they get to work on the exhaust. They replaced the damaged pipe and replaced the gaskets and exhaust hardware at no charge to me. One thing to note is that I didn't ask for a freebie or any special treatment. I literally was at the shop waiting for all but 30-45 mins tops including the time I spent shooting the shyt with Clint and Jeremy and watching a GTR dyno a few times.

I am not affiliated/sponsored by AAM, I'm not a local shop fanboy nor was I asked by anyone to write this. I simply wanted to share my experience where I received superb customer service as well as a company standing behind their product. Big thanks goes to Clint and the techs for hooking me up!
